Ubuntu Tribe — Mumbai

Billboard campaign coordinated with launch press coverage

Ubuntu Tribe, a tokenized gold platform, wanted physical visibility in Mumbai to reinforce a digital launch campaign aimed at India's financial districts. We booked billboard and transit placements across the city and timed them to land in the same week as coordinated press coverage. The creative ran in Hindi and pointed straight at the product rather than at the technology behind it. The placements reached 20M+ in physical traffic, giving the launch a presence in the streets its audience actually moves through — something press coverage on its own cannot do.

What drives scope

What drives scope and budget on an OOH engagement

Cost is driven by geographic scope, placement premium and creative complexity.

Geographic scope

A single-city campaign is lightest. Multi-market placement across several countries scales cost significantly.

Placement premium

Standard billboard placement is one budget. Prime locations — Times Square, major transit hubs — cost meaningfully more.

Format mix

Static billboards are simplest. Digital-OOH, transit wraps and print together require more coordinated production.

Timing rigidity

A flexible placement window is cheaper than a hard-locked launch date requiring guaranteed availability.

Creative complexity

A single static creative is light. Multiple format-specific creative variants add production scope.

Campaign duration

A one-week burst is different budget from a sustained multi-month presence in a target market.
